[1][2] After leaving school she began working in the theatre, making her debut at the Casino in Nice in Lecocq’s La petite mariée.

[4] Her career took off in 1894: she joined the Bouffes-Parisiens, making her debut there creating the role of Clotilde in Varnay’s Les Forains (February 1894), and Edwige in Le bonhomme de neige by Antoine Banès (April 1894).

[4] June that year saw her at the Théâtre des Menus-Plaisirs in the title role of Audran’s Miss Helyett alongside Jean Périer.
